The sample is an Excel 4.0 macro sheet (XLM) that contains an Auto_Open macro. The macro attempts to bypass security by instructing the user to 'Enable Editing' and 'Enable Content'. The extracted macro code includes a command that reconstructs the URL "http://0xc12a24f5/cc.html" and executes it using 'cmd /c'. This indicates the document is a downloader designed to fetch and execute a second-stage payload from the specified URL.

Heuristics 3

  • Excel 4.0 Auto_Open defined name critical OLE_XLM_AUTOOPEN_DEFINEDNAME
    oletools recovered an Auto_Open / Auto_Close entry from an Excel 4.0 macro sheet. The raw BIFF name can be tokenized or partially opaque to byte-string checks, but the recovered macro listing confirms the workbook has an XLM auto-execution entry.
  • Excel 4.0 (XLM) macro sheet present medium OLE_XLM_AUTOOPEN
    Workbook contains an Excel 4.0 macro sheet sub-stream — XLM is rarely seen in modern legitimate workbooks and was a major Office malware vector during 2020-2022.
  • Macro/content-enable lure medium SE_ENABLE_LURE
    Document instructs the user to enable macros or editing — a common technique used by malware droppers to bypass Office macro security settings
